What Is an Errata Sheet?



An errata sheet is a vital device in lawful solutions documentation, supplying improvements to errors recognized in formerly published products. You could encounter it in contracts, briefs, or various other lawful papers where precision is vital. Essentially, an errata sheet provides details mistakes and their adjustments, guaranteeing quality and accuracy in the legal language used.


When you find an error, you'll desire to resolve it without delay to maintain professionalism and trust and integrity. An errata sheet assists you connect these modifications to all relevant parties, reducing confusion and prospective conflicts. It's not just a basic improvement; it represents your commitment to maintaining high standards in your legal documentation.

Ideal Practices for Implementing Errata Sheets



To guarantee clearness and precision in legal documents, implementing errata sheets efficiently is crucial. Start by clearly identifying the errata sheet accordingly, guaranteeing it's easily recognizable. Consist of a quick intro that details the purpose of the document, so everybody comprehends its relevance.


Next, list each mistake systematically, providing the initial message alongside the remedied version. This format helps viewers quickly understand the changes. Make certain to date the errata sheet and include the names of those in charge of the modifications, promoting accountability.


Distribute the errata sheet to all parties associated with the documentation, and think about integrating it right into the initial record for simple recommendation. Keep records of all errata sheets for future compliance checks.
